Dear Parents~

Article posted May 31, 2012 at 02:13 PM GMT • comment • Reads 3104

I give you back your child, the same child you entrusted to my care last fall. I give him/her back pounds heavier, inches taller, months wiser, more responsible and more mature than he/she was then. Although he/she would have attained this in spite of me, it has been my happy privilege to watch his/her personality unfold day by day and marvel at each new achievement, each new success, each new expansion of self.

I give him/her back reluctantly; for having spent nine months together in the narrow confines of a crowded classroom, we have grown close, have become part of each other and shall always be one another’s friend. We have lived, loved, laughed, played, studied, learned, and enriched our lives together this year. I wish it could go on indefinitely, but give him/her back I must.

Take care of him/her for he/she is precious and one of a kind. Remember that I shall always be interested in your child and his/her destiny, wherever he/she goes, whatever he/she does, whoever he/she becomes. I have loved being a part of his/her life.
Thank you for sharing such an amazing child with me!
